
When it comes to relationships, the age-old debate rages on: Do women prefer the steady, dependable man or the thrill of an unpredictable one? Some argue that security and loyalty win every time, while others believe excitement and passion take priority. The truth is attraction isn’t always so black and white. Women often find themselves torn between these two archetypes—Mr. Reliable and Mr. Exciting—each offering different strengths. So, what do women actually want in a partner? Let’s break it down.
1. Stability Matters More Than Most Admit
At the core of any long-lasting relationship is a foundation of trust and reliability. Women want to know that their partner is someone they can count on, especially when life throws unexpected challenges their way. Mr. Reliable brings emotional stability, financial security, and a sense of comfort that makes a relationship feel like home. While spontaneous adventures are fun, knowing that a partner will show up, listen, and be there through thick and thin holds more value in the long run. The excitement of passion fades if there’s no real sense of safety in the relationship.
2. Excitement Keeps the Spark Alive
While reliability is important, a relationship that lacks excitement can quickly feel stagnant. Mr. Exciting brings spontaneity, adventure, and a sense of unpredictability that makes things feel fresh and fun. Women appreciate partners who plan surprise dates, introduce them to new experiences, and keep the energy dynamic. The rush of passion and thrill of the unknown can create an emotional high that deepens connection. However, too much unpredictability without a foundation of trust can lead to instability rather than excitement.
3. Emotional Depth Wins Over Surface-Level Fun
Attraction isn’t just about who can provide the best adventures or the most stability—it’s about who makes a woman feel truly seen and understood. Women want a partner who listens, validates their feelings, and creates emotional intimacy. A man who offers deep conversations and makes a woman feel valued will always stand out. Mr. Exciting may bring fun, but if he lacks emotional depth, his appeal fades over time. Mr. Reliable may not always be thrilling, but if he provides emotional security, his presence becomes irreplaceable.
4. Confidence Is Key—But So Is Vulnerability

Confidence is undeniably attractive, but arrogance or emotional unavailability can be a turnoff. Women want a man who is self-assured but also emotionally open. Mr. Exciting often exudes confidence, but if he avoids vulnerability, it can create emotional distance. On the other hand, Mr. Reliable may be steady, but if he lacks confidence or assertiveness, the relationship may feel too predictable. The ideal balance is a partner who is both strong and emotionally available, creating a secure yet passionate connection.
5. The Right Man Combines Both Qualities
The truth is women don’t want to choose between reliability and excitement—they want both. A man who is dependable but also knows how to keep things interesting is the ultimate dream. Relationships thrive on a mix of security and adventure, stability and passion. The best partners find ways to be reliable without being boring and exciting without being reckless. Striking this balance is what keeps relationships strong, fulfilling, and long-lasting.
Finding the Right Balance in Love
So, is Mr. Reliable better than Mr. Exciting, or is it the other way around? The answer isn’t simple because women want both stability and excitement in a partner. A relationship needs a foundation of trust, but it also needs spontaneity to keep things fresh. The ideal man understands that being a great partner isn’t about fitting into one category—it’s about evolving, growing, and maintaining a balance.
